Unmissable Heritage and Thrilling Outdoor Pursuits

Pune's identity is deeply rooted in its magnificent landmarks and accessible natural surroundings. Shaniwar Wada, a historic fort situated centrally, stands as a prime cultural landmark, which brings Pune’s rich Maratha heritage to life through captivating light-and-sound shows, a top daytime attraction for history buffs.

Adventurers gravitate towards the Sinhagad Fort Trek, a highly popular trekking spot approximately 30 kilometres from the city centre, which effortlessly combines the thrill of outdoor exertion with breathtaking views and a tangible taste of history.

Serene Settings and Urban Entertainment Hubs

For travellers looking for relaxed, scenic enjoyment, Pune offers beautifully maintained green spaces and modern urban playgrounds, providing ample fun activities in Pune. The Pune-Okayama Friendship Garden, or Pu La Deshpande Udyan, is a stunning Japanese-style sanctuary, offering perfectly serene settings for a tranquil day out and picturesque photography sessions.

Likewise, the Empress Botanical Gardens spans an impressive 39 acres, boasting spectacular floral displays, designated play areas for children, and idyllic picnic spots suitable for family leisure.

As the sun sets, Koregaon Park transforms into the city’s undisputed hub for vibrant nightlife, trendy cafes, and lively pubs, making it the perfect destination for evening entertainment.

For those whose idea of fun involves retail therapy and complex entertainment, Phoenix Marketcity & Seasons Mall serve as premier shopping destinations, complete with extensive entertainment zones, multi-screen cinemas, and expansive food courts.

Finally, for an adrenaline rush, Panshet Water Park & Adventure Sports, located roughly 40 kilometres from Pune, is dedicated to offering thrilling water slides, relaxing boating, and a variety of other high-energy adventure activities.

Culinary Adventures: The Taste of Pune

Indulging in Pune’s dynamic culinary landscape is considered one of the most rewarding and fun activities in Pune, transforming simple dining into a core part of the city experience. We highly recommend seeking out Pune’s diverse culinary delights at local eateries and vibrant street food hubs, where local dishes reveal the city’s character.

Visitors must try iconic local dishes such as Vada Pav and Misal Pav from authentic local vendors. Furthermore, bustling locations like FC Road are renowned not only for their accessible shopping but also for their array of snacking opportunities, offering a genuine taste of Pune's everyday life and cultural vibrancy.
